A tax deduction, or "write off" as it's sometimes called, reduces your taxable income by getting you to subtract facts an expense from your income, before calculating simply how much tax require to pay. The more deductions experience or the higher the deductions, the less your taxable income. Also, additional you lessen taxable income the less exposure you will be required to the higher tax rates in the bigger income wall mounts. As you read earlier, Canada's tax system is progressive thus the more you earn, the higher the tax rate. Cutting your taxable income reduces the amount of tax you'll pay.

330 of 365 Days: The physical presence test is simple to say but tend to be hard to count. No particular visa is necessitated. The American expat will not need to live any kind of particular country, but must live somewhere outside the U.S. to the 330 day physical presence study. The American expat merely counts we all know out. Every single day qualifies generally if the day is any 365 day period during which he/she is outside the U.S. for 330 full days greater. Partial days in the U.S. are viewed as U.S. events. 365 day periods may overlap, each day will be 365 such periods (not all that need qualify).
